    • The gas-blast circuit breaker, which is preferably provided for switching medium-high voltages, has two arcing and two rated-current contacts each of which are located in a housing filled with insulating gas and operate in conjunction with each other. For purposes of a compact construction, electric connections, are carried into the interior of the housing transversely to the direction of movement of one moving contact of the two arcing contacts. The driving energy required for a switching process is intended to be kept as low as possible while retaining the compact construction. This is achieved by the fact that the moving rated-current contact is rotatably supported and that a drive, acting on the moving arcing and the moving rated-current contact has two rods which are pivoted at a driving crank, one of which rods is pivoted at the moving arcing contact and the other one of which is pivoted at the moving rated-current contact. In this arrangement, the two insulating rods are pivoted at the driving crank in such a manner that, during the disconnecting process, a thrust crank formed by the driving crank, one rod of insulating material and the moving arcing contact passes through a dead-center position before the disconnected condition has been reached.

    • A device for separably assembling first and second enclosures of an electric cut-out apparatus, said enclosures being filled with a dielectric fluid under pressure and having a rod for operating the cut-out apparatus passing therethrough with the compressed fluid in each of said enclosures being in communication with the compressed fluid in the other enclosure when the cut-out apparatus is in operation. The assembly device includes an intermediate slidable sealing air lock (41) which seals the first chamber and the second chamber. The air lock includes first and second separable portions (7,45) which are fast with respective ones of said enclosures. The operating rod (42) inside the air lock is separable into first and second portions (6,12) which are fast with respective ones of said enclosures. The invention applies in particular to compressed gas high tension circuit breakers.

    • A safety device for preventing overpressures in low pressure reservoirs receiving compressed gas through a feedline connected to a high pressure source is disclosed including a spherical stopcock in the feedline. A cylinder is provided in pressure communication with the low pressure reservoir with a spring-biased piston arranged within the cylinder. Connected to the piston and projecting from the cylinder is a toothed rack having teeth which intermesh with teeth of a rotatable, toothed segment connected to the stopcock. Motion of the piston, in response to pressure changes in the low pressure reservoir, causes the toothed rack to open or close the stopcock. A hole in the wall of the cylinder allows excess compressed air or gas to escape to the atmosphere in the event that the maximum allowable pressure within the low pressure reservoir is exceeded.

    • A thermometer unit for monitoring the temperature of a fluid cooled electric transformer, the thermometer unit having a ceramic body insertable between the coils of the transformer winding immersed in cooling fluid in the transformer case. A nylon rod responsive to heat changes is confined in the interior of the body and is adapted to expand and contract according to the heat changes to vary volume flow of a gas circulated by a pump in a closed circuit connected with the body. Variations in the gas pressure are indicated on a sight gage externally of the transformer.
